SERVICE OPERATIONS SUPPORT MANAGER

Job Location

Kempton Park, South Africa

Job Description

Minimum requirements: Experience in a background managing Field Service and Workshops Partner with the various Sales Areas in Africa. Will need to travel frequently within Africa to support the various Sales Areas. About the role As a Service Operational Support Manager, will play a pivotal role in driving operational excellence across service organizations in Africa. Will: - Champion continuous improvement, lean practices, and standardization across service operations. - Support Service Digital Transformation - Support implementation and execution of global standards, processes and systems - Provide inputs and supports for Real Estate team - Partner with Service Excellence Team to ensure seamless execution of processes, standards and improvement plans, for workshops and Field services - Partner with CSM and Portfolio Managers to ensure seamless execution and introduction of contracts and products. - Ensure compliance with policies and standards. - Provide strategic input to Business Line Managers, CSMs, Portfolio managers, Service Excellence and Digital Transformation Teams on service requirements, offerings and technical support capabilities. - Support Business Performance Manager and monitor service contracts in the respective Sales Areas to ensure performance meets or exceeds contractual obligations and cost targets. - Support service workshops in the respective Sales Areas operations, ensuring optimal cost, utilization, quality, and cycle times. - Support field service execution and performance management in the respective Sales Areas. - Drive KPIs including workshop efficiency, service utilization, order intake vs. forecast, WIP aging, and service profitability. Profile Looking for a results-driven and experienced leader with a strong background in service operations and heavy engineering. The ideal candidate will have: - At least 5 years of experience in a management or leadership role. - A background in Engineering or Business Administration (minimum 5 years preferred). - Proven experience managing heavy engineering workshop facilities. - Exposure to mobile mining equipment in workshop and field service environments. - Strong knowledge of service contract management and performance metrics. - Qualifications or experience in Six Sigma or similar productivity improvement programs. - A passion for continuous improvement, workforce development, and operational excellence.
